Types of Treadmills
When it comes to choosing a treadmill, it is important to comprehend the various types readily available in the market. Here are the primary classifications:
1. Handbook TreadmillsMechanism: These treadmills have a basic design and rely on the user's efforts to move the belt.Pros: More economical, quieter operation, no electrical power required.Cons: Limited functions, may not supply the very same variety of exercise intensity.2. Motorized TreadmillsSystem: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, enabling users to stroll or run at a set speed.Pros: Greater range of speeds and slopes, geared up with various features such as heart rate screens and exercise programs.Cons: More expensive and might need more upkeep.3. Folding TreadmillsMechanism: Designed for those with limited area, these treadmills can be folded for simple storage.Pros: Space-saving, typically motorized, versatile features.Cons: May be less long lasting than non-folding models.4. Commercial TreadmillsSystem: High-quality machines designed for usage in fitness centers and gym.Pros: Built to withstand heavy usage, advanced features, typically consist of service warranties.Cons: Pricey and not ideal for Home treadmills Uk use due to size.5. Treadmills provide numerous benefits that can add to one's overall health and wellness objectives. Some of these benefits include:

When choosing a treadmill, possible buyers must think about a number of essential aspects:

How often should I use a treadmill?
It is recommended to utilize a treadmill a minimum of three to five times a week, integrating different intensity levels for best results.
2. Can I drop weight by using a treadmill?
Yes, consistent use of a treadmill can contribute to weight loss, particularly when combined with a balanced diet plan and strength training.
3. What is the very best speed to walk on a treadmill for newbies?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is an ideal variety for newbies. It's important to begin slow and slowly increase rate as convenience and endurance enhance.
4. Do I require to utilize a treadmill if I currently run outdoors?
Using a treadmill can provide additional advantages, such as regulated environments and differed workouts (slope, intervals) that are not always possible outdoors.
5. How do I keep my treadmill?
Regular upkeep consists of lubricating the belt, cleaning up the deck and console, and inspecting the motor for optimal performance.
